Key Takeaways
- Acne can be broadly divided into non-inflammatory and inflammatory lesions, with different effects on the skin.
- Blackheads and whiteheads mainly involve blocked pores and surface congestion, while papules and pustules involve inflammation.
- Inflammatory acne can leave post-inflammatory redness or hyperpigmentation after active lesions resolve.
- Deep nodules and cysts carry a greater risk of permanent scarring because inflammation can damage deeper skin tissue.
- Treatment should account for the type and severity of acne as well as concerns such as pigmentation, scarring, dryness, and skin sensitivity.
Introduction
Acne develops when hair follicles become blocked by sebum and dead skin cells. Bacteria and inflammation can also contribute to the development of certain acne lesions. However, not every type of acne affects the skin in the same way.
Some lesions remain close to the skin’s surface, while others involve inflammation deeper within the follicle. These differences influence whether a person is more likely to experience congestion, pigmentation changes, persistent redness, or permanent scarring.

Non-Inflammatory Acne and Surface Congestion
Non-inflammatory acne mainly consists of comedones, which develop when follicles become blocked with sebum and dead skin cells. These lesions generally cause less swelling and tissue damage than inflammatory acne.
The two main types are:
| Type | What Happens | Common Skin Concern |
| Open comedones | The blocked follicle remains open, and its contents darken through oxidation | Blackheads and visible congestion |
| Closed comedones | The follicle opening is covered by skin | Whiteheads and uneven skin texture |
Although comedonal acne does not usually involve significant inflammation, persistent blockage can make the skin feel rough or uneven. Closed comedones may also become inflamed, potentially developing into papules or pustules.
Skin products that are too occlusive for an individual’s skin may contribute to follicular blockage. At the same time, aggressive cleansing can irritate the skin without addressing the underlying formation of comedones.
Non-inflammatory acne primarily affects pores and surface texture. When inflammation develops, however, the risk of longer-lasting skin changes increases.
Inflammatory Acne and Pigmentation Changes
Inflammatory acne includes papules and pustules. Papules are raised, inflamed lesions without visible pus, while pustules contain pus near the surface.
Inflammation can affect the skin even after an active spot has flattened. Common post-acne changes include:
- Post-inflammatory hyperpigmentation: Excess melanin production can leave brown, grey, or darker marks, particularly in darker skin tones.
- Post-inflammatory erythema: Dilated or damaged superficial blood vessels can leave persistent pink, red, or purplish marks.
- Temporary sensitivity: Inflamed or recently healed areas may be more sensitive to irritating products.
- Uneven appearance: Repeated outbreaks can result in active acne and residual marks appearing simultaneously.
These flat colour changes are not the same as permanent acne scars because they do not necessarily represent structural changes in the skin. They can gradually fade, although the time required varies.

Inflammatory acne is more likely than comedonal acne to leave persistent colour changes. These marks should be distinguished from true scarring before treatment is selected.
Nodules, Cysts, and Acne Scarring
Nodules and cystic acne develop deeper within the skin and involve substantial inflammation. Because deeper tissue is affected, these lesions have a higher risk of causing permanent scars.
Acne scarring can take several forms:
| Scar Type | Typical Appearance |
| Ice-pick scars | Narrow, deep depressions |
| Boxcar scars | Wider depressions with relatively defined edges |
| Rolling scars | Broad depressions that create an uneven or undulating surface |
| Hypertrophic or keloid scars | Raised areas caused by excess scar tissue |
Scarring occurs when inflammation damages collagen and surrounding tissue during acne healing. Picking, squeezing, or repeatedly manipulating deep lesions can increase tissue injury and may raise the likelihood of visible marks or scars.
Management depends on whether the main concern is active acne, pigmentation, structural scarring, or impaired skin barrier function. Nodules and cysts present the greatest concern for permanent structural scarring. Early management of severe inflammatory acne can help reduce ongoing inflammation and the risk of additional scars.
FAQs
Which type of acne is most likely to cause scarring?
Deep inflammatory acne, particularly nodules and cysts, carries a higher risk of permanent scarring because inflammation extends further into the skin.
Are dark marks after acne considered scars?
Not necessarily. Flat brown or darker marks are commonly post-inflammatory hyperpigmentation, while true scars involve structural changes such as depressions or raised tissue.
Can blackheads and whiteheads become inflammatory acne?
Yes. A blocked follicle can become inflamed, resulting in lesions such as papules or pustules.
Does picking acne increase the risk of marks?
Picking or squeezing lesions can increase inflammation and tissue injury. This may contribute to pigmentation changes and increase the risk of scarring, particularly with deeper acne.
